Are you curious about the country code “65” and which country it belongs to? Well, let me unravel this mystery for you. The country code “65” is associated with none other than the vibrant city-state of Singapore.

When you dial a phone number starting with the country code 65, you are connecting to someone in Singapore. This small but mighty nation has gained a global reputation for its bustling economy, efficient infrastructure, and diverse cultural landscape.
